Output 15c80f312ba1f423e0b56d636486d2efa6cee7409728c8b219f3d223d65d3559:6

value
3009166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7c1d453723b49286f15d7e5fb7909c6d64798d7 OP_EQUAL
address
3KuEbDkhBUC3cKmbHs9NBk4LjhdRPnSAJ4
transaction
15c80f312ba1f423e0b56d636486d2efa6cee7409728c8b219f3d223d65d3559
spent
true